Hornbach to open store in Timisoara this summer

German DIY retailer Hornbach has begun work on its fifth local store which should be opened this summer inTimisoara. The shop will have a sales surface of 22,500 sqm and requires a EUR 30 million investment.

Hornbach entered the local market in 2007 and has since opened four local branches inBucharest(three outlets) andBrasov. The retailer’s last local opening was in December 2010.

The Romanian DIY market has been shrinking in recent years as real estate investments have plummeted. The market is one of the most competitive at local level but, even so, Horbanch managed to increase its business in 2011 against the previous year, Mugurel-Horia Rusu, general director of HornbachRomania, told BR, without disclosing the actual figure. Hornbach posted a turnover of about EUR 71 million in 2010, according to data from the Ministry of Finance.

Moreover, in the first financial quarter of this year (March-May) the retailer says it reported positive results.

Other international players on the local DIY market are Praktiker, Bricostore, BauMax, Obi and Leroy Merlin. Local retailers include Dedeman, Arabesque and Ambient.

Investment in new DIY units considerably decreased last year with only eight new large stores being opened. Out of this figure, five outlets belong to market leader Dedeman, which is owned by local businessmen Dragos and Adrian Paval. The other three were opened by French Bricostore, Austrian BauMax and French newcomer Leroy Merlin.

One of the worst affected players by the decrease of the market over the past few years has been Praktiker which saw sales go down by 24 percent in the first nine months of 2011. The German DIY retailer’s sales on the local market have been sliding since 2008.
